Overview

The Radeon RX 6800S is manufactured by AMD. It was released in January 4 2022. It features the RDNA 2.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 1800 MHz to 2100 MHz. It has 2048 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 100W. Manufactured using 7 nm process technology. It features 32 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 15,841 points.

Graphics Performance

The Radeon RX 6800S scores 15,841 in the G3D Mark benchmark (the standard measure of rasterization GPU performance), placing it in the High-End tier as a Aging generation graphics card. It is built on the RDNA 2.0 architecture (codename: Navi 23), manufactured on a 7 nm process— smaller process nodes improve power efficiency and transistor density. It packs 2048 shader units (the primary compute units for rendering pixels), 128 TMUs (texture mapping units), and 64 ROPs (render output units that handle final pixel output). Raw FP32 compute power: 8.602 TFLOPS — this measures the theoretical peak floating-point performance. Boost clock reaches 2100 MHz from a base of 1800 MHz.

Video Memory (VRAM)

The Radeon RX 6800S is equipped with 8 GB of GDDR6 video memory connected via a 128-bit memory bus, delivering 256 GB/s of bandwidth. GDDR6 provides fast memory access for gaming and compute workloads. Memory operates at 16 Gbps effective speed.

Advanced Features & APIs

The Radeon RX 6800S supports modern upscaling and frame generation technologies: FSR Frame Generation, AMD Fluid Motion Frames, Radeon Super Resolution, FidelityFX Super Resolution — these can dramatically boost effective FPS by generating intermediate frames or upscaling from lower internal resolution. Graphics API support: DirectX 12 (12_2), Vulkan 1.3, OpenGL 4.6— latest API versions enable the most advanced rendering features like ray tracing and mesh shaders.

Display & Media

Display outputs: 1x Laptop Dependent — supports up to 4 simultaneous displays. Hardware encoder: RDNA 2 Media Engine, decoder: RDNA 2 Media Engine— dedicated hardware for video encoding/decoding accelerates streaming, recording, and video playback. Supported codecs: H.264,HEVC,VP9,AV1.
